Understanding Dried Fruits and Their Weight Loss Benefits

Dried fruits are fresh fruits with moisture removed through natural sun-drying or mechanical dehydration, creating concentrated nutrition that enhances any fat-loss strategy. Rich in fiber, beneficial fats, protein, essential vitamins, and antioxidants, they accelerate metabolism, control hunger pangs, and encourage fat burning.

Essential Guidelines for Weight Loss with Dried Fruits

  • Choose only unsweetened, natural varieties
  • Follow portion guidelines (20–30 grams per day)
  • Maintain proper hydration due to the concentrated nature
  • Pair with consistent physical movement for optimal outcomes
